Why do hockey players smell smelling salts?

Waved under the nose, the smelling salts stimulate the vagus nerve—the “motor nerve” of the heart and bronchi. The ammonia provides the punch and is essentially a gas-powered irritant that jolts the nerves—and the mind—into sharp, sudden wakefulness.

What is the stuff athletes smell?

What are smelling salts? Share on Pinterest An athlete may use smelling salts to increase their alertness and focus. Smelling salts are a combination of ammonium carbonate and perfume. However, today’s smelling salts are more likely to contain diluted ammonia dissolved with water and ethanol.

Why do hockey players sweat so much?

Additionally, hockey players wear layers of dense protective equipment, and the game is characterized by repeated, high-intensity skating sprints, all of which are factors that lead to increased sweating.

Why does hockey sweat smell so bad?

The smell is actually bacteria that are brought on by a perfect petri dish of sweat, wet equipment and lack of air circulation. Unfortunately, everything about the sport of hockey allows for the ripe opportunity (pun intended) for the bacteria to grow, too.

What are hockey players sniffing?

Those players are sniffing ammonia laced smelling salts. The theory is that they give increased alertness, energy levels, extra strength, speed, open nasal passages, elevated heart rate, increased brain activity and blood pressure.

How much weight do hockey players lose?

During the course of an average game, some players can lose as much as 5 to 8 pounds. This loss is mostly water, so players are concerned about making sure they keep enough fluids in their bodies.
